Corkite-Hinsdalite Series

A solid-solution series between two end-member minerals
This page is currently not sponsored. Click here to sponsor this page.
Hide all sections | Show all sections

About Corkite-Hinsdalite SeriesHide

Series Formula:
PbFe3(PO4)(SO4)(OH)6 to PbAl3(PO4)(SO4)(OH)6
A series between Corkite and Hinsdalite
